The United States acquired textile technology know-how in a variety of ways throughout its history. Some key ways include:

  • Immigration: Many skilled textile workers immigrated to the United States from Europe, particularly from England, Scotland, and Ireland, bringing with them knowledge and expertise in textile production.

  • Industrial espionage: During the early days of the American textile industry, some textile manufacturers engaged in industrial espionage, stealing technological secrets from British textile companies.

  • Innovation and experimentation: American textile manufacturers also developed their own textile technology through innovation and experimentation. American inventors such as Samuel Slater and Francis Cabot Lowell made significant contributions to the development of textile machinery and production methods.

  • Education and training: American textile manufacturers also invested in education and training for their workers, establishing schools and training programs to teach the latest textile production methods.

  • Importing machinery: American textile manufacturers also imported textile machinery from Europe, particularly from England, which was then considered to be the leader in textile technology.

It is important to note that, while the United States was able to gain the know-how in textile technology, it was not able to surpass the technology and expertise of British textile industry, who remained the leader in textile production for a long time. However, the US textile industry, with the help of technological advancements, grew and became one of the most important industries in the country.wen

How exactly did New England get Textil technology know-how in early 19th century ?

In the early 19th century, the textile industry in New England was primarily focused on the production of hand-woven wool and cotton textiles. However, with the invention of the power loom in the 1820s and 1830s, the textile industry began to rapidly industrialize.

One of the key ways that New England textile manufacturers obtained knowledge and technology related to the power loom was through the recruitment and hiring of skilled textile workers and engineers from Great Britain.

During this time, Great Britain was the global leader in textile production, and many skilled textile workers and engineers emigrated to the United States in search of better economic opportunities. These immigrants brought with them knowledge and expertise related to the latest textile technologies and manufacturing methods, which they shared with American textile manufacturers.

In addition, textile manufacturers in New England also sent agents to Great Britain to observe and learn about the latest textile technologies and manufacturing methods.

Another way that New England textile manufacturers obtained knowledge and technology related to the power loom was through the development of new technologies and manufacturing methods by American inventors and engineers. For example, Lowell and Slater, were two of the most important textile innovators of the time and they were both American.

Finally, the government also played a role in the growth of the textile industry by providing funding and support for the development of new textile technologies and by enacting protectionist policies to support American textile manufacturers.

It is important to note that the textile industry was one of the most important industries in the early 19th century and it played a key role in the rapid industrialization of New England and the United States as a whole.
